Transaction 3258a71f895b97e24d5f35a5bc8ef70877e104db4236a8286805a30115db8b22

1 Input
2 Outputs
  • 3258a71f895b97e24d5f35a5bc8ef70877e104db4236a8286805a30115db8b22:0
  • value  557257
    address  3L7hSz9ZTw1DJmN9cDUTd6qEmt3H2KCTsT
  • 3258a71f895b97e24d5f35a5bc8ef70877e104db4236a8286805a30115db8b22:1
  • value  17377889
    address  bc1q7zzzpjlm6jahsaz4szzdylajrmc7v59qcec4hm6gfgcm94awjkrseuwcgy